6/3/26- Day 3 - Clyde Smith Shelter to mile 1840

Updated: Jun 5

Made it through another day of climbing. I was hoping after 2 straight days of climbing day three might have been a little flatter, but no such luck. The day started, and finished, bright and clear which was a welcome change, and it was cool enough for great hiking. The elevation change was nearly as great as the first few days. Today’s last 6 miles were all up hill, except for the last .4. The good news is, tomorrow, I descend from my current 5200 feet to 1800 in the town of Irwin. I’ll spend one night there, to pick up a box and get cleaned up, then head to Hot Springs for another break.


My legs should be ready after another day or two. It’s hard to train in Iowa, because the curbs are the highest thing around.


Time to sign off for another night.


Whistler out.
